Output 1c41138cc6015ce889ea924d78c2f05e70ecddcf3176c65394a757bcff5b023f:1

value
288000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c038cceec8cde2f1b8a8646b9a4dc825b1f5ff28 OP_EQUAL
address
3KDPhwjFmVSaFGbqX3agHiM8NyzMt5b6yx
transaction
1c41138cc6015ce889ea924d78c2f05e70ecddcf3176c65394a757bcff5b023f
confirmations
200066
spent
true